The Regulatory Framework: A Double-Edged Sword?
France’s approach to online gambling is a curious blend of strict regulation and cautious openness. The Autorité Nationale des Jeux (ANJ) oversees the industry, ensuring operators comply with licensing requirements and player protection standards. While this might sound reassuring, it also means many international platforms are off-limits, leaving French players with a somewhat limited buffet of choices.
Some might argue that this regulatory environment stifles innovation, while others appreciate the safety net it provides. The question remains: does this framework truly serve the player’s best interests, or is it more about control than convenience?

Tips for Managing Your Bankroll Online
- Set a budget before you start playing and stick to it, no matter how tempting the next spin looks.
- Use deposit limits and self-exclusion tools offered by the platform to avoid chasing losses.
- Keep track of your wins and losses to maintain a clear picture of your gambling habits.
- Consider smaller bets to extend your playtime and reduce volatility.
- Don’t fall for the illusion that bigger bets always mean bigger wins.
